Improved Coordination and Balance
Functional strength training significantly enhances coordination and balance by engaging multiple muscle groups simultaneously. Exercises like single-leg squats and dynamic movements improve neuromuscular connections, boosting reflexes and stability. This reduces injury risk, enhances athletic performance, and improves everyday mobility. By mimicking real-life movements, functional training strengthens the body’s ability to adapt to various physical demands, ensuring better overall coordination and balance; These benefits are particularly evident in programs like the RCMP Functional Strength & Conditioning Program, which emphasizes practical, adaptable exercises tailored to improve functional fitness and real-world application.

Setting SMART Goals
Setting SMART (Specific, Measurable, Achievable, Relevant, Time-bound) goals is essential for a functional strength training program. Goals should align with personal fitness objectives, such as improving endurance or increasing muscle strength. For example, aiming to complete 10 pull-ups in 8 weeks is specific and measurable. Ensuring goals are achievable prevents discouragement, while relevance keeps the program focused. Time-bound deadlines, like completing a 12-week program, maintain motivation and track progress. Regularly reviewing and adjusting goals ensures continued growth and success in the training journey. SMART goals provide clarity, direction, and accountability, making the program more effective and enjoyable. They guide the structure and intensity of workouts, ensuring long-term success and satisfaction.

Bodyweight Exercises
Bodyweight exercises are a cornerstone of functional strength training, offering simplicity and effectiveness. They engage multiple muscle groups, improving coordination, balance, and overall muscular endurance. Movements like push-ups, squats, lunges, and planks are versatile and require no equipment, making them accessible anywhere. These exercises enhance functional strength by mimicking real-life movements, ensuring practical applications. They also allow for progressive overload through variations like single-leg squats or plyometric push-ups, catering to different fitness levels. Bodyweight training is an excellent starting point for those new to strength training or seeking a balanced, functional fitness routine.

Progression and Scaling in Functional Training
Progression and scaling are crucial for continuous improvement in functional training. As fitness levels advance, exercises can be modified by increasing weight, reps, or complexity. Gradually introducing more challenging movements ensures sustained progress. Scaling allows individuals to adjust workouts to their current ability, preventing plateaus and injuries. Periodically reassessing strength and endurance helps tailor the program effectively. Incorporating variations, such as tempo changes or unilateral exercises, further enhances adaptability. Consistent progression keeps the program engaging and aligned with long-term fitness goals, ensuring a balanced and evolving approach to strength and functional development.

The RCMP Functional Strength & Conditioning Program
This program is a sequential fitness training system designed to enhance overall physical performance. It consists of four levels, starting with foundational movements and progressively increasing intensity. Level 1 focuses on building core strength, stability, and basic functional movements. Each subsequent level introduces more complex exercises, ensuring a well-rounded development of strength, endurance, and coordination. The program emphasizes scalability, making it suitable for individuals at various fitness levels. By following this structured approach, participants can improve resilience, reduce injury risk, and achieve long-term physical adaptation. It’s a practical choice for those seeking a systematic path to functional strength.
